Gillian Anderson
David Duchovny is 5’11¾". It’s not surprising that in order to get a good shot, Gillian Anderson needed to look higher than she was (5’3″). She remembers that when the characters needed to enter a room and show their badges at the same time, she had to jump onto something high to look taller. One time, she turned to the camera quickly and fell down because she had forgotten she was on a box.

Ingrid Bergman
If you watch Casablanca carefully, you may notice that the height difference between Ingrid Bergman and Humphrey Bogart is never consistent. The thing is, the director wanted to hide the fact that Bergman was taller than Bogart. To create the illusion of the opposite, the director made Bogart sit on boxes and pillows, and in some scenes, Bergman even had to slouch.

Michael Clarke Duncan
In The Green Mile, Michael Clarke Duncan looks like a giant compared to his colleagues. In fact, he’s just 1 cm taller than David Morse. Duncan was 6’4″, Hanks is 6′, and Morse is 6’3½". To create an optical illusion, the crew used very different tricks. For example, Duncan’s bed was smaller than usual to make him look huge. The same was true for all the other pieces of furniture he was near.
